It took me two hours to go shopping in the supermarket yesterday. D. It took me going shopping two hours in the supermarket yesterday. READING Pharmacy is a profession, a business and a science. It is one of the world’s oldest professions and is the companion of medical, dental, and public health sciences. A pharmacist compounds, preserves, and dispenses drugs. He understands their chemical properties and how they are manufactured and used. He is also able to test them for purity and strength. A pharmacist assumes responsibility for human life. To avoid causing harmful reaction and bringing death to man, he fulfills his duties with accuracy, cleanliness and orderliness. He should be willing to check and double check his job. Working with people constantly, he must have good judgment and tact. Above all, he must set for himself high ethical standard because he is entrusted with the storage and distribution of dangerous drugs. V. TRUE (ĐÚNG) / FALSE (SAI) (1 pt) ________ 1.
